Tune In: Austin City Limits This Weekend!

Mark your calendars now...
This Saturday, January 23, we are performing on the longest-running music series in American television history, Austin City Limits!

To get you all ready for the big show:
You can read our program preview, set list, and a have a look at photos from our recording now on austincitylimits.com.

ACL is also featuring a clip of our "I and Love and You" performance, which you can watch here!

Austin City Limits airs on PBS: check here for your local listing.

Can't wait for you to see it!

Best,
The Avett Brothers

According to the review (see link below), the full set list is as follows. I would love to see the full taping. Anyone know if it will be available anywhere?

http://www.austin360.com/blogs/content/shared-gen/blogs/austin/mo/entrie...

Setlist for “Austin City Limits” taping
1. “Laundry Room”
2. “Go to Sleep”
3. “And it Spread”
4. “Salina”
5. “I and Love and You”
6. “Paranoia in B Flat Major”
7. “January Wedding”
8. “Head Full of Doubt/Road Full of Promise”
9. “Murder in the City”
10. “Die Die Die”
11. “Salvation Song”
12. “When I Drink”
13. “Slight Figure of Speech”
14. “Please Pardon Yourself”
15. “The Perfect Space”
16. “Colorshow”
E: “Talk on Indolence”
